Secrets of the formation of a compact gloxinia bush

young gloxinia When breeding gloxinia, a common defect is a violation of the normal development of the plant, namely, when the bush takes on a disheveled shape. The shoots of the flower begin to stretch, and the flower itself falls on its side. This creates certain inconveniences in care, in addition, the bush loses its compact appearance and may even break. What is the reason for this phenomenon and how to help the plant?

Causes of "disheveled" gloxinia

If the bush gloxinia began to lose its shape and stretch, there is no need to look far for the cause. Most often this occurs as a result of a violation of conditions of detention, namely a combination of two factors:

  • insufficient lighting;
  • high air temperature.

This combination is typical for the winter period, when the heating batteries begin to work, and the duration of daylight hours is significantly reduced. Just in the period when the tubers wake up, the shape of the bush is largely determined.

Gloxinia will grow lush and beautiful if, from the beginning of germination of tubers to flowering, you provide it with a comfortable temperature and good lighting.

How to prevent stretching of gloxinia?

The most suitable place for a flower is in the southwest window sill. If the pot is on the north window, it is necessary to provide the plant with additional lighting in winter so that it does not stretch in search of light.

Daylight hours should be at least 12 hours.

As for the temperature, it is undesirable to place the flower next to the radiator - hot and dry air emanates from it. It is better that the air temperature in the room where gloxinia grows is at the level of 18-20 degrees.

How to get Gloxinia back into a compact form?

If it was not possible to save the flower, and it still lost its shape, this does not mean that one can say goodbye to the bush. Fortunately, the situation can be corrected using a simple method.

So what needs to be done with the elongated bush? In late spring, after the first flowering, the ground part of the plant should be cut off. Moisten the rest (tuber) and place the pot in a bright place. It is better to choose a window that does not open in order to protect the flower from a possible draft.

By the beginning of summer, new sprouts will hatch from the tuber. Since there is enough light during this period, the new shrub will grow compact and lush.
